If you were writing a series of Cadfael-type Mysteries set early in the reign of Jaehaerys the First (think Dunk & Egg in Septon’s robes) then what area of the Seven Kingdoms & what aspects of the period do you think would make for the most interesting focus?

image

Great question!  

  • I would definitely recommend the Bracken/Blackwood feud and the disputed lands between their two castles as a good place for a murder mystery that can tie in to Jaehaerys’ mediation of the feud.
  • the North or the Wall during Jaehaerys and Alysanne’s progress and the handing-over of the New Gift.
  • Oldtown during the negotiations between the High Septon and Septon Barth over the disarmament of the Faith Militant.
  • the Inn at the Crossroads during a royal inspection of the Kingsroad.
  • the Great Tourney of 98 AC would be a great backdrop.
  • Aemon’s death and the Second Quarrel.
  • the Great Council of 101 AC and the Lannister gold.
